Repair Café returns to Quay Arts

pic: Quay Arts

A pop-up Repair Café will take place at Quay Arts, in Newport, tomorrow (Saturday) offering people the chance to have broken household items fixed by volunteers, rather than sending them to landfill.

Visitors can bring clothing, small electricals, electronics, computers, tablets, phones or small pieces of furniture. Repairs are carried out with the owner involved, helping build skills and confidence to tackle future fixes at home. Some items, such as microwave ovens, cannot be repaired for safety reasons.

Free tickets must be booked in advance, selecting both a repair type and time slot to help match items with available volunteers. Book one ticket per item; if a category shows as unavailable, a repairer with those specific skills is not available for that session.

The Repair Café runs from 10am to 2pm and entry is free. Booking details are available at iw.observer/repair-cafe.
